About CHAI
CHAI is dedicated to saving lives and reducing disease burdens in low-and middle-income countries. Initially founded to combat HIV/AIDS, CHAI has expanded its focus to include COVID-19, malaria, tuberculosis, hepatitis, non-communicable diseases, and more. The organization works closely with governments and private partners, emphasizing sustainable impact at scale.
